/etc/net Scripts 0.9.2
/etc/net represents a new approach to Linux network configuration tasks. more>>
/etc/net represents a new approach to Linux network configuration tasks. /etc/net Scripts is inspired by the limitations of traditional configuration subsystems.
/etc/net provides builtin support for configuration profiles, interface name management, removable device support, full iproute2 command set support, interface dependency resolution, and a QoS configuration framework.
/etc/net provides support for the following interface types: Ethernet, WiFi (WEP), IPv6/IPv6 tunnels, PSK IPSec tunnels, VLAN, PLIP, Ethernet bonding and bridging, traffic equalizer, Pent@NET, usbnet, and PPP.
Due to its modular design, support for new interface types can be added without overall design changes.
Enhancements:
- This release features mostly new features (ip6tables, ebtables, OpenVPN, and tun/tap) and some bugfixes (IP rules, wireless, firewall, and DVB).

Net-SSH2 0.09
Net-SSH2 is a SSH 2 protocol interface. more>>
Net-SSH2 is a SSH 2 protocol interface.
SYNOPSIS
Top
use Net::SSH2;
my $ssh2 = Net::SSH2->new();
$ssh2->connect(example.com) or die;
if ($ssh2->auth_keyboard(fizban)) {
my $chan = $ssh2->channel();
$chan->exec(program);
my $sftp = $ssh2->sftp();
my $fh = $sftp->open(/etc/passwd) or die;
print $_ while < $fh >;
}
Net::SSH2 is a perl interface to the libssh2 (http://www.libssh2.org) library. It supports the SSH2 protocol (there is no support for SSH1) with all of the key exchanges, ciphers, and compression of libssh2.
Unless otherwise indicated, methods return a true value on success and false on failure; use the error method to get extended error information.
The typical order is to create the SSH2 object, set up the connection methods you want to use, call connect, authenticate with one of the auth methods, then create channels on the connection to perform commands.

net-tools 1.60
net-tools are programs that form the base set of the NET-3 networking distribution. more>>
The net-tools package contains a collection of programs that form the base set of the NET-3 networking distribution for the Linux operating system.
It contains the important tools for controlling the network subsystem of the Linux kernel including arp, hostname, ifconfig, netstat, rarp and route.

Net::Pcap 0.12
Net::Pcap is an Interface to pcap(3) LBL packet capture library. more>>
Net::Pcap is an Interface to pcap(3) LBL packet capture library.
SYNOPSIS
use Net::Pcap;
my $err = ;
my $dev = Net::Pcap::lookupdev($err); # find a device
# open the device for live listening
my $pcap = Net::Pcap::open_live($dev, 1024, 1, 0, $err);
# loop over next 10 packets
Net::Pcap::loop($pcap, 10, &process_packet, "just for the demo");
# close the device
Net::Pcap::close($pcap);
sub process_packet {
my($user_data, $header, $packet) = @_;
# do something ...
}
Net::Pcap is a Perl binding to the LBL pcap(3) library. The README for libpcap describes itself as:
"a system-independent interface for user-level packet capture.
libpcap provides a portable framework for low-level network
monitoring. Applications include network statistics collection,
security monitoring, network debugging, etc."

Net::CSTA 0.03
Net::CSTA project is a perl-module for talking to an ECMA CSTA Phase I server. more>>
Net::CSTA project is a perl-module for talking to an ECMA CSTA Phase I server.
ECMA CSTA is a ASN.1 based protocol for building CTI applications. Typical use include subscribing to events (aka moinitoring), placing and modifying calls.
This module only support CSTA Phase I (mainly because that is what I have access to). The module has been tested with Ericsson AL 4.0 (application link) with an MD110.
SYNOPSIS
use Net::CSTA;
# Connect to the CSTA server
my $csta = Net::CSTA->new(Host=>csta-server,Port=>csta-server-port);
# Create a monitor for 555
my $number = 555;
$csta->request(serviceID=>71,
serviceArgs=>{monitorObject=>{device=>{dialingNumber=>$number}}})
for (;;)
{
my $pdu = $csta->receive();
print $pdu->toXML();
}

/etc/net 0.8.5
/etc/net represents a new approach to Linux network configuration tasks. more>>
/etc/net represents a new approach to Linux network configuration tasks. Inspired by the limitations of traditional configuration subsystems, /etc/net provides builtin support for:
- configuration profiles
- interface name management
- removable devices
- full iproute2 command set
- interface dependencies resolution
- QoS configuration framework
- firewall support (NEW)
/etc/net provides support for the following interface types:
- Ethernet
- WiFi (WEP)
- IPv4/IPv6 tunnels
- PSK IPSec tunnels
- VLAN
- PLIP
- Ethernet bonding and bridging
- traffic equalizer
- usbnet
- PPP (PPtP, PPPoE)
Due to its modular design, support for new interface types can be added without overall design changes. /etc/net consists of core scripts (stable) and GUI configurator (development). Both parts are licensed under GPL.
